In this episode of Other People's Money, Max Wiethe sits down with hedge fund manager Russell Clark to discuss why he believes the U.S. Treasury market is a much larger and more dangerous speculative bubble than AI. Clark details his macroeconomic outlook, arguing that a shifting political landscape focused on 7% wage growth and lower living costs will eventually push the 10-year Treasury yield up to an astonishing 10%. To stabilize affordability for younger generations, he predicts real estate will remain flat nominally while heavily declining in real terms. Clark also breaks down the massive capital expenditures in AI, viewing them as defensive strategies by legacy tech giants to protect their moats rather than mere speculation. Finally, Clark also warns about sectors reliant on low rates and the severe illiquidity and mispriced risks currently lurking within the private credit and private equity markets.
